"Made from 100% Pinot Noir from Grand Crus vineyards in the Bouzy subregion. Four years en tirage. It has an almost perfumed aroma with chocolate box, cherry blossom flavours and a good influence of bready and toasted nut autolysis" Bob Campbell, Master of Wine, Real Review Dec 2021

"Just as good as last time it was tasted, although this bottle seems especially fresh and delicate, with a refinement that is perhaps not classic blanc de noirs, but seems to suggest some chardonnay in the mix (but there is none). Lovely wine indeed" Huon Hooke, Real Review, Oct 2019

"The effusive nose of candied citrus, ripe pear and brioche pulls you into this fresh and creamy champagne that hits all the pleasure buttons for a non-vintage Brut. Then the chalky freshness at the finish pulls you back for another sip. Excellent balance! 100% Pinot Noir. Drink now" The Wine Advocate, Apr 2021

"Enchanting pale golden in the glass boasting aromas of citrus with ripe orchard fruits and are subtle biscuity almond touch. This stunning grower Champagne has a creamy, refined palate that lingers. Pear and nut follow through from the bouquet, highlighted by a creamy and floral feel" James Suckling, Jul 2022

The harvest is manual and takes a large selection of clusters to remove those who have not aged well. The winemaking is done in a traditional winery, almost archaic. A former high vertical press gets fine and balanced must go to small tubs where they conduct the alcoholic fermentation between 16 º C and 18 º C, and malolactic to 18 º C. The wine is aged in the cellars of the family to 10 feet deep, with disgorgement removed and manuals.

Owner Jean-François Clouet - The man and his cuvées are deeply rooted into the multilayered and convoluted history of Champagne, arguably more than any other. He is the privileged custodian of eight hectares of estate vines in the best middle slopes of Bouzy and Ambonnay, the epicentre of pinot noir in Champagne. His family heritage in Bouzy extends back to 1492 and they have been making their own champagnes here since the early 1700s.
